SAULT STE. MARIE, Ont. – A Nolan Nemecek man advantage effort with just over 12 minutes remaining proved to be the game-winner as the Soo Thunderbirds went on to edge the Soo Eagles 4-3 in a Northern Ontario Junior Hockey League match-up Saturday at John Rhodes Community Centre.

Renewing acquaintances, the long-time rivals saw the Thunderbirds strike first as Rex Rhodes banged in his initial league marker past the midway point of the first period by finishing off a nice cross-ice feed from Lucas DiBeradino past goalkeeper Jace Knoerle.

Countering with a tying tally in the final minute of the frame, off an ill-timed pinch, Jack Ohlund took a Cooper Fredericks pass on a two-on-one and whipped it paced T-Birds netminder Lincoln Mellenthin.

In the second stanza, the guests went in front at 5:20 after Ohlund went in on a breakaway off a turnover and after being denied by a nice pad save by Mellenthin, saw Lucas Caulfield pounce and stuff in the rebound.

Coming back to knot it at 2-2, Colin Chesnut clicked for T-Birds halfway through the proceedings as he notched his first in the NOJHL by taking a pass across at the blueline, then darting in and ripping it into the top corner.

In the third, Cooper Labelle put the home side ahead as he knocked in a rebound off a Lucas Willoughby opportunity.

Nemecek then made it 4-2 with the Thunderbirds on a power play as he scored from the same spot on the ice as Labelle by finishing off a Chesnut chance.

Up a skater themselves, Fredericks brought the Eagles back to within one with half a period to go by putting one through traffic from the top of the right circle.

There would be no further scoring however and T-Birds skated away with the win in their home opener.
